CBN Governor Emefiele Suspended, Faces Investigation

Less than two weeks after assuming office as President and Commander-in-Chief of the Armed Forces, President Bola Ahmed Tinubu has suspended the Central Bank of Nigeria (CBN) Governor, Godwin Emefiele, from office with immediate effect. The suspension, according to a statement issued and signed by the Director of Information in the Office of Secretary to the Government of the Federation (OSGF), Willie Bassey, on Friday night, said the suspension came into effect as part of investigation of his office and the planned reforms in the financial sector of the economy. The statement noted that Emefiele has been directed to immediately hand over the affairs of his office to the Deputy Governor (Operations Directorate), who will act as the Central Bank Governor pending the conclusion of investigation and the reforms. UNIVERSITY UNDERGRADUATE, FOUR OTHERS ARRESTED FOR VANDALIZING EEDC PROPERTY

A vandal suspect identified as Samuel Ebuka Umenze, an indigene of Amesi, Aguata Local Government Area, Anambra State, was on Tuesday arrested for his role in vandalizing property of the Enugu Electricity Distribution Company PLC (EEDC) within the school premises. Samuel, a first-year student of Agric Extension with the University of Nigeria, Nsukka (UNN), was arrested at the school premises by the institution’s security, while large quantities of peeled coated cables and sophisticated equipment used for vandalism were recovered from his room. This was made known in a statement issued by the Head, Corporate Communications, EEDC, Mr. Emeka Ezeh, in Enugu on Friday. According to him, Samuel, while confessing to the crime, claimed he carries out the criminal act alone at night during classes and sells his loot to a buyer in Onitsha. Fuel Subsidy: NLC, TUC suspend strike

  THE Organised Labour made up of the Nigeria Labour Congress, NLC, and the Trade Union Congress of Nigeria, TUC, yesterday agreed to suspend its planned strike scheduled to begin tomorrow to enable further negotiations with the Federal Government. This was part of the resolutions reached at the end of the meeting late yesterday evening. Monday’s meeting and resolution were attended and signed by Mr Femi Gbajabiamila, Chief of Staff to the President; Festus Osifo, President, TUC; Nuhu Torò, Secretary General, TUC; Joseph Ajaero, President, NLC; Emmanuel Ugboaja mni, General Secretary, NLC and Ms Kachollom S. Daju, Permanent Secretary, Federal Ministry of Labour and Employment. Other resolutions arrived at the meeting include: “Continued engagements by the TUC and the NLC with the Federal Government and secure closure on the resolutions above. “The Labour Centres and the Federal Government are to meet on June 19, 2023, to agree on an implementation framework. Energy Theft: We Won't Succumb To Cheap Blackmail, EEDC Tells Uwazurike, MASSOB Leader'

The Enugu Electricity Distribution Company PLC (EEDC) has described as cheap blackmail, a viral video where Chief Uwazurike, leader of the Movement for the Actualization of the Sovereign State of Biafra (MASSOB), alleged that his staff were abducted by the company. Uwazurike also alleged that EEDC was being used by the state to get at him. In a reaction, the EEDC said it was a private, non-political, and non-partisan business enterprise, saddled with the responsibility of distributing electricity across the five South East states. EEDC said it had suffered high prevalence of energy theft, meter bypass and other electricity infractions within the network and that the ugly trend had consistently and negatively impacted its output and revenue. This according to the company, prompted the Federal Government to set up a task force known as Special Investigation and Prosecution Task Force on Electricity Offenders (SIPTEO).
